Can U Go In A Hot Tub While Pregnant. Using a hot tub during pregnancy can be safe as long as you take the necessary precautions and follow the latest hot tub safety advice. There’s not much research on the safety of using hot tubs while pregnant. It is recommended that pregnant women don’t stay in a hot tub any longer than 10 minutes at a time, if soaking at a safe. Most experts don’t expressly forbid using a hot tub if you’re expecting. Can you get into a hot tub while pregnant? While you don't need to switch to cold showers, it's probably a good idea to skip the hot tub and the sauna when you're pregnant. While sitting in a sauna or soaking in a hot tub may seem like the perfect remedy to soothe your pregnancy aches and pains, both activities are risky. Remember to consult with your doctor or. Is it safe to use hot tubs while pregnant? However, the american college of obstetricians and gynecologists recommends against it.
